What are the most common Mercedes-Benz repair issues for drivers in the Ingleside, IL area?

Given our local climate with cold winters and road salt, common issues include premature brake corrosion, suspension component wear from potholes on roads like Route 12, and battery failures. Many Ingleside owners also report issues with the COMAND infotainment system and air suspension leaks as vehicles age.

What local driving conditions in Ingleside should influence my Mercedes-Benz maintenance schedule?

The seasonal extremes and use of road salt mean you should adhere strictly to undercarriage washes in winter and consider more frequent brake inspections. Also, the mix of rural roads and highway driving on I-94 can lead to earlier-than-expected wear on tires and wheel alignment.

When should I seek service for a warning light on my Mercedes-Benz, and are there trusted local shops for diagnostics?

Seek service immediately for red warning lights (like brake or engine), and schedule a prompt diagnostic for amber lights. Several specialized shops in the area have the latest Mercedes STAR Diagnostic systems, which are essential for accurately reading codes and preventing misdiagnosis on these complex vehicles.
